For those having problems with games freezing or only booting partially, how did you rip the game?

When using FSD to copy the game to disc sometimes my file count or disc use wouldn't match that of the game.  For the mismatched ones, you either have to break down the game via PC and FTP it over or copy it to the HDD using NXE then use NXE2GOD.  NXE is actually much faster ripping the games because it reads the disk in large pieces rather than file by file.

I still have a few games that nothing will read by any means, but that's just bad media.

H.A.W.X has the same problem, it seems that some of the filenames on the DVD are longer than the 42 (I think its 42), so the workaround you suggest for a GOD container works fine or you can copy to a fat32 formatted USB drive which has a much greater filename length.
